wifi: mt76: mt7921: fix rx filter incorrect by drv/fw inconsistent

The rx filter, in mt7921 series, may be changed in fw operation. There is
a racing problem if rx filter controlled by both driver and firmware at
the same time. To avoid this issue, let mt7921 driver set rx filter by new
command MCU_CE_CMD_SET_RX_FILTER and allow the firmware controlling it
only.
